  • Question 1
    1 / -0
    Name the type of following chemical reaction.

    $$CaCO_3 \rightarrow CaO + CO_2$$
    Solution
    A decomposition reaction is a type of chemical reaction in which a single compound breaks down into two or more elements or new compounds. These reactions often involve an energy source such as heat, light, or electricity that breaks apart the bonds of compounds.

    $$CaCO_3 \rightarrow CaO + CO_2$$

  • Question 6
    1 / -0
    Name the type of following chemical reaction.
    $$KNO_3 + H_2SO_4 \rightarrow HNO_3 + KHSO_4$$
    Solution
    A double displacement reaction is a type of reaction where part of one reactant is replaced by part of another reactant.
    Double displacement reactions take the form:
    AB + CD $$\rightarrow$$  AD + CB
    $$KNO_3 + H_2SO_4 \rightarrow HNO_3 + KHSO_4$$

  • Question 8
    1 / -0
    Name the type of following chemical reaction.

    $$PbO_2 + SO_2 \rightarrow PbSO_4$$
    Solution
    A synthesis reaction or direct combination reaction is a type of chemical reaction in which two or more simple substances combine to form a more complex product. The reactants may be elements or compounds. The product is always a compound.

    $$PbO_2 + SO_2 \rightarrow PbSO_4$$
